Finish Woodwork Service in Kansas City, KS
Finish woodwork services encompass the detailed craftsmanship involved in enhancing the appearance and durability of interior and exterior wood features within a property. These services typically include finishing touches such as staining, sealing, varnishing, and polishing wood surfaces, as well as refinishing existing woodwork like trim, moldings, doors, and cabinetry. Homeowners often seek finish woodwork services to improve the aesthetic appeal of their living spaces, protect wood surfaces from wear and moisture, or restore the original beauty of older wood features.
Before requesting finish woodwork services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of finishes available, and the condition of existing wood surfaces. It is helpful to consider the specific areas or features requiring attention, whether it’s a single room or multiple spaces, and to have a clear idea of the desired look or protective finish. Additionally, understanding any necessary surface preparation or repairs can assist in planning for a smooth and successful project.

Common Finish Woodwork Service Jobs
Cabinet refinishing - restoring the finish on existing wood cabinets for a fresh look.
Custom wood trim - installing or replacing crown molding, baseboards, and decorative trims.
Door and window casings - adding or updating casings to enhance interior or exterior woodwork.
Built-in shelving - creating custom shelves and storage solutions to maximize space.
Wood paneling - installing or repairing wall paneling for aesthetic or functional purposes.
Furniture restoration - repairing or refinishing wood furniture to preserve its appearance and value.
Finish Woodwork Service Questions
What types of finish woodwork services are available? Services include custom cabinetry, trim installation, staircases, and decorative moldings to enhance interior and exterior spaces.
Are finish woodwork services suitable for historic homes? Yes, these services can restore or replicate original wood features to preserve historic character.
What finishes are typically used in woodwork projects? Common finishes include staining, varnishing, and painting to protect and enhance the wood's appearance.
Can finish woodwork be customized to match existing décor? Absolutely, finishes and styles can be tailored to complement existing interior design and architectural details.
